What is March Madness?

March Madness is one of the most exciting times of the year for college basketball fans. The NCAA tournament brings together the best teams from around the country to compete in a single-elimination bracket. If you're looking to get in on the action, a printable version of the March Madness bracket is a must-have. With a printable bracket, you can follow along with the tournament, make your picks, and compete with friends and family to see who can correctly predict the most games.

The March Madness bracket is a 68-team tournament, with teams competing in a series of games to determine the national champion. The tournament is divided into several rounds, including the First Four, the Round of 64, the Round of 32, the Sweet 16, the Elite 8, and the Final Four.
